Summary: The suit (Suit No. 200 of 2024) between Farah Kairus Siganporia (Plaintiff) and Shiromi Donesh Felfeli & Anr. (Defendants) in the Bombay High Court has been disposed of based on a settlement agreement (Consent Terms dated 9th April 2026) signed by all parties. The court accepted the Consent Terms with no order as to costs, and all pending interim applications have been disposed of accordingly with any interim orders vacated.
